If I could give this zero stars I would. I booked tickets for their Halloween themed bar called Wonky Bar. If you go Thursday - Saturday you have no choice but to pay $30 PER PERSON for a reservation. The reservation was supposed to include a “show” and a wonka bar with a chance of winning a golden ticket - some sort of prize to the restaurant. It didn’t even include a drink. The overly sweet cocktails were $15 or more a piece, and there were only 3 wildly overpriced food options - cheap charcuterie on a novelty ferris wheel, greasy sausage rolls and fries, and an overpriced grilled cheese sandwich. The “show” was nothing more than an obnoxious magician, who did a 10 minute opening act, then was supposed to walk around to each table and give some sort of a private show. Which only included petty card tricks. Well my group and I were there for over an hour, and the magician didn’t come by our table at all. He spent all his time on just one side of the room, and could care less about the other side of the room. The bar was also so poorly decorated - the staircase was more decorated than the inside. Inside there was essentially only a low cost vent pipe with a printed photo of Augustus Gloop, and some homegoods apothecary jars with candy. The Dream Hotel’s Candy Factory Bar - which is FREE - is a much better alternative - far more innovative and they are not forcing anyone to pay for a reservation. For $30 a person, I expected so much more. I basically paid $30 a person for a cheap sub-par chocolate bar. This place should be ashamed of themselves - the Wonky Bar is nothing but a shameless cash grab. Don’t waste your time or your hard earned money.
